     COMMENTS: AstraZeneca Follows Gangsters

Monday, ABC's Pierre Thomas filed an Investigates feature pointing the finger at organized crime gangs--Armenians in California, Nigerians in Texas, Cubans in Florida, Russians in the northeast--for running medical supply rackets to defraud Medicare. Now Thomas names AstraZeneca, the pharmaceuticals manufacturer, for "bilking taxpayers out of tens of millions of dollars." Thomas explained that AstraZeneca's scheme involved paying physicians for speaking engagements and sending them on travel junkets as incentives to have them prescribe the schizophrenia medication Seroquel for other, unapproved, mental illnesses such as dementia and depression. "Thousands of lawsuits have been filed against the company by patients complaining about side effects from Seroquel ranging from rapid weight gain to the onset of diabetes," Thomas told us. AstraZeneca is paying a $520m fine.
